Indian national kills Nepali man over minor dispute
An Indian national killed a Nepali man following a minor dispute in Kailali district on Saturday.
The Indian national identified as Manka Sardar, 38, who was living in Bahuniya-7, Kattipur, had hit Ishwari Tamrakar, 22, of Jhagadpur with a piece of wood to the back of the head , police said. Sardar was irritated with Tamrakar as the latter's tractor was billowing too much dust in the road.
Tamrakar, who was seriously injured after being knocked out by Sardar, died a little later while undergoing treatment at local Sairam Clinic.
Sardar, a local contractor, surrendered to the police immediately after the incident.
Police said they are investigating the case. Nepalnews.com
